Budgeting software application helps you strategy, track, and projection how your nonprofit will use its money. Accounting tools record what's currently taken place, like earnings, expenditures, and bank reconciliations.

Managing the monetary complexities of not-for-profit organizations presents countless obstacles. Unlike standard businesses, which focus on revenue, nonprofits need to focus on transparency, compliance, and mission-driven responsibility. This shift in priorities brings unique complexities when it pertains to financial management. Nonprofits need to not only ensure they are financially viable but also that they are liable to donors, grantors, and regulatory bodies.

These specialized options simplify fund accounting, streamline donor management, and boost monetary reporting to make sure compliance and openness. Without the ideal software application, nonprofits may have a hard time with tracking restricted funds, handling varied earnings streams, and meeting audit requirements.
